In many different ways, Lilly Network colleges and universities intend that the Christian identities of their institutions should shape their undergraduates' experience鈥攖hat students should be somehow formed by the faith commitments of their schools.

We hear anecdotally about how this happens, in the classroom and beyond. But what would we learn from more systematic analysis? How do undergraduates experience their own intellectual and social enlargement in relation to faith commitment? Are young people indeed exploring how their professional and personal paths intersect with faith-informed narratives? Are their patterns of church affiliation affected by what they learn or do as students?

Join us at 四虎影院 College September 27-29, 2024 for "Hearts and Minds: Undergraduate Spiritual and Intellectual Development at Lilly Network Institutions," hosted by 四虎影院's Gaede Institute for the Liberal Arts. The centerpiece of the conference will be a new study, commissioned by the Lilly Network and implemented by Springtide Research Institute, that investigates the intellectual-religious experience of undergraduates at Lilly member schools. Springtide's director, Tricia Bruce, will present findings from that study, Fuller Seminary's Steve Argue will provide additional framing about young-adult development, and a panel of religious-life professionals drawn from Lilly campuses will give a snapshot of what they've seen with their students.

Tricia Bruce

is the director of Springtide Research Institute, which seeks to learn from and about young people ages 13 to 25. Her sociological work explores organizational and attitudinal change across a variety of settings, and she has a particular interest conveying the dynamics of social life to non-sociologists. Dr. Bruce is the author of five books, the president-elect of the Association for the Sociology of Religion, and a previous chair of the religion section of the American Sociological Association. She holds a PhD in sociology from the University of California, Santa Barbara.

Steven Argue

is associate professor of youth, family, and culture at Fuller Theological Seminary and the applied research strategist at the Fuller Youth Institute; his current projects include a significant research effort to understand young adults' spiritual journeys and the role of congregations in supporting them through key transitions. Dr. Argue is the author of several books including Young Adult Ministry Now and Growing With: Every Parent's Guide to Helping Teenagers and Young Adults Thrive in Their Faith, Family, and Future, and he speaks, writes, and consults on topics related to adolescence, emerging adulthood, and faith. He holds a PhD in higher adult and lifelong education from the University of Michigan.
